Ballajura lake walks, leash rules and useful observations

The City of Swan dog guidance lists both Emu Lakes and Central Lakes as places that are not off-leash dog exercise areas, so dogs must remain on lead there. This corrects the wording on XCura’s older Ballajura page, which incorrectly described them as designated dog-exercise areas.

After a walk around the lakes or another local reserve, a problem may become clearer once your dog settles at home. Note the exact time you first saw limping, repeated licking, a damaged nail, a tender paw, itching, a wound, coughing or unusual tiredness. If the sign comes and goes, a short video of normal walking, rising or breathing can preserve what you saw before the appointment.

For the visit itself, include the easiest parking place, house number, driveway, gate and entrance in the booking request. Bring your dog indoors before the arrival window. These details help Dr Noor carry the examination kit and medicines directly to the correct door and begin with your pet calm and secure.

Why a home visit can help Ballajura pets and families

Transport can add a second problem to veterinary care. A painful or older dog may struggle to climb into the car, while a frightened cat may hide when the carrier appears or arrive too stressed for its usual behaviour to be visible. A home consultation lets Dr Noor observe how the pet moves, rests and responds before transport changes the picture.

Home visits are also useful when several pets share the house or a family is balancing work, school and caring responsibilities. Keep animals that are not being examined in another room until they are needed, and list every pet requiring attention in the original request. This gives XCura the information needed to prepare the appointment correctly.

Preparing your Ballajura home and pet

  • Share clear parking, driveway, house-number, gate and entrance instructions.
  • Bring dogs indoors before the arrival window and keep their lead nearby.
  • Place cats in a small, secure room 15–20 minutes before arrival, before they can hide or escape outside.
  • Choose a quiet, well-lit area and gather medicine packets, records, test results, photographs and videos.
  • Mention a recent lake, reserve or neighbourhood walk if the timing may relate to the concern.
  • Tell XCura beforehand about bite history, defensive behaviour, handling difficulty, infection concerns or another safety issue.
